how many electrons does magnesium need to lose to get a full other shell?
Answers
Answered by
0
Answer:
two electrons
Explanation:
Magnesium is in Group II and has two electrons in its valence shell. Thus it tends to lose two electrons. In this case, the next set of electrons closer to the nucleus is the new valence shell, and it is full.
